Rough ultrasonic velocity measurements are as simple as measuring the time it takes for a pulse of ultrasound to travel from one transducer to another pitch catch or return to the same transducer pulse echo. Young s modulus of elasticity poisson s ratio acoustic impedance and several other useful properties and coefficients can be calculated for solid materials with the ultrasonic velocities if the density is known see appendix x1.
